public inbox for u-boot@lists.denx.de
 help / color / mirror / Atom feed
* [U-Boot] Bare x86 support is merged to u-boot-x86
@ 2014-11-25 21:51 Simon Glass
  2014-11-25 22:08 ` Andy Pont
                   ` (3 more replies)
  0 siblings, 4 replies; 15+ messages in thread
From: Simon Glass @ 2014-11-25 21:51 UTC (permalink / raw)
  To: u-boot

Hi Bin (and others interested in U-Boot on x86),

I've applied the remaining x86 patches to u-boot-x86. It runs on
chromebook_link (Pixel) with support for most hardware relevant to a
boot loader: SDRAM, SPI, PCI, USB (and USB Ethernet), SATA (internal
32GB SSD), SD card, LCD, UART, keyboard, EC.

Bin this should be a good base for you to send patches for your Atom
platform and I have no major work pending now so should not get in
your way.

Instructions on how to build and run are here:

http://www.denx.de/wiki/U-Boot/X86

For this platform 4 binary blobs are needed. This is an unavoidable
feature of the platform at present. The blobs cover flash descriptor,
SDRAM init, video init and Management Engine. Instructions on how to
get these are on the same page.

Here is a list of some missing features:

- README.x86 in the source (mostly the content from the Wiki page
would be a good start)
- MTRR support (for performance)
- Audio
- Chrome OS verified boot (only a rough rebase has been done, I'm not
sure how to track mainline anyway)
- SMI and ACPI support, to provide platform info and facilities to Linux

Regards,
Simon

^ permalink raw reply	[flat|nested] 15+ messages in thread

end of thread, other threads:[~2014-12-03  1:47 UTC | newest]

Thread overview: 15+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2014-11-25 21:51 [U-Boot] Bare x86 support is merged to u-boot-x86 Simon Glass
2014-11-25 22:08 ` Andy Pont
     [not found] ` <5474fdd8.4b582a0a.0366.4001SMTPIN_ADDED_BROKEN@mx.google.com>
2014-11-27  0:05   ` Simon Glass
2014-11-27  7:59     ` Joakim Tjernlund
2014-11-27 16:31       ` Simon Glass
2014-11-27 17:08         ` Joakim Tjernlund
2014-11-27 21:05           ` Simon Glass
2014-11-27  1:44 ` Bin Meng
2014-11-27  3:35   ` Simon Glass
2014-12-01 19:33 ` Bruce_Leonard at selinc.com
2014-12-01 20:14   ` Simon Glass
2014-12-01 20:28     ` Bruce_Leonard at selinc.com
2014-12-02  4:38       ` Bin Meng
2014-12-02 16:02         ` Christian Gmeiner
2014-12-03  1:47           ` Bin Meng

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ox